Following thorough investigations by detectives and subsequent advice from the Office of the Director of Public Prosecutions (ODPP), Margaret Wairimu Magugu is to be charged with the offence of giving false information to a person employed in the public service.
The charges stem from an ongoing investigation being conducted by detectives from the Land Fraud Investigation Unit (LFIU), in which Mrs Magugu is the complainant against Karura Investment Ltd.
She is accused of knowingly providing false information to investigators in an attempt to mislead the inquiry and wrongfully implicate the suspect.
The matter was mentioned today before the Milimani Law Courts for plea-taking. However, Mrs Magugu failed to appear in court and was represented by her advocates, who informed the court that she had fallen ill earlier in the day and was therefore unable to attend.
The court adjourned the matter and set January 13, 2026, as the date for plea-taking, marking it as the final adjournment.
